What you will be doing

The IT Infrastructure & Security Manager is a highly practical, hands-on role responsible for the day-to-day running, maintenance, and support of the company’s core infrastructure, networks, telephony, and server environments.

Working closely with the Head of IT, you’ll be the go-to technical lead for resolving complex issues, managing incidents, maintaining system performance, and ensuring secure, stable operations across on-prem and cloud services. This role involves direct configuration, troubleshooting, patching, monitoring, and upgrading of systems—while also guiding and supporting the IT Systems Administrator through technical mentoring and daily workload leadership.

With responsibility for maintaining accreditations such as ISO27001 and Cyber Essentials Plus, and for getting hands on with networking, firewalls, backups, M365, Azure, Intune, and VMware technologies, this role suits someone who loves being immersed in the technical detail while keeping the environment robust, secure, and running smoothly.
